:cool: welcome to mixvibes fourm ,, glad you are enjoying the software ,, info needed on your set up to explain how to record your mixes ,, ie your sound config wheather it is internal mixer or external ,,
internal will allow for recording the master channel or selective channels ,, thru the rec function ,, little red button in gui ,,
external will be slightly different , refer to the manual for full/better explaination :cool:

All paid versions have the option to record your mix to hdd.

So all you need is a little spare cpu capacity and disk space.
